arm64: ssbd: Introduce thread flag to control userspace mitigation
In order to allow userspace to be mitigated on demand, let's introduce a new thread flag that prevents the mitigation from being turned off when exiting to userspace, and doesn't turn it on on entry into the kernel (with the assumption that the mitigation is always enabled in the kernel itself). This will be used by a prctl interface introduced in a later patch. Change-Id: I9583873ac796489eba615e857cb9f21adcef2179 Reviewed-by:Mark Rutland <mark.rutland@arm.com> Acked-by:
